Brown Brothers Harriman & Co. Has $849,000 Stake in Stericycle, Inc. (NASDAQ:SRCL)

Brown Brothers Harriman & Co. lowered its holdings in Stericycle, Inc. (NASDAQ:SRCLFree Report) by 17.9% in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 14,605 shares of the business services provider’s stock after selling 3,187 shares during the period. Brown Brothers Harriman & Co.’s holdings in Stericycle were worth $849,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Stericycle,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ides regulated waste and compliance services in the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company offers regulated waste and compliance services, including regulated medical waste, sharps waste management and disposal, pharmaceutical waste management and disposal, chemotherapy waste and disposal, controlled substance waste disposal, healthcare hazardous waste, and integrated waste stream solutions; specialty services, such as MedDrop medication collection kiosks, safe community solutions, SafeDrop sharps mailback solutions, and airport and maritime waste services; medical supply store services, that includes sharps and disposable biohazardous waste containers, infection control supplies, and seal&send medication mail back; and compliance solutions including Steri-Safe compliance solutions.
